Firm predicts top hotspots for 2009

Wednesday, December 31, 2008

British Airways has come up with a list of destinations it thinks will be particularly good to visit during 2009.

Topping the chart was Cape Town, with Johannesburg taking second place thanks to it being all set to host the British Lions tour.

Dubai came third, with American cities San Francisco and New York completing the top five.

Hong Kong, St Kitts, St Lucia, Sydney and Shanghai completed the compilation.

British Airways' head of UK and Ireland sales Richard Tams said that the credit crunch is not stopping die-hard travellers.

"It's not all doom and gloom for travel in the current economic climate … savvy flyers know there are still bargains to be had," he commented.

City guide publisher DK Eyewitness Travel also recently published a list of 2009 travel hotspots, which included Vilnius in Lithuania, Copenhagen and Seattle.

These places were chosen for their array of cultural attractions, as well as for their hotels and restaurants.
